- FUNCTION: Plays a critical role in catalyzing the release of class II HLA-associated invariant chain-derived peptides (CLIP) from newly synthesized class II HLA molecules and freeing the peptide binding site for acquisition of antigenic peptides.
- SUBUNIT: Heterodimer of an alpha chain (DMA) and a beta chain (DMB).
- SUBCELLULAR LOCATION: Late endosome membrane; Single-pass type I membrane protein. Lysosome membrane; Single-pass type I membrane protein. Note=Localizes to late endocytic compartment. Associates with lysosome membranes.
- POLYMORPHISM: The following alleles of DMA are known: DMA*0101, DMA*0102, DMA*0103 (DMA3.2) and DMA*0104 (DMA3.4). The sequence shown is that of DMA*0101.
- SIMILARITY: Belongs to the MHC class II family.
- SIMILARITY: Contains 1 Ig-like C1-type (immunoglobulin-like) domain.
